A Graduate Certificate in Business Acquisition Strategies for Small Businesses provides focused training on successfully navigating the complexities of mergers and acquisitions (M&A) in the small business landscape. This specialized program equips participants with the essential skills and knowledge needed to identify, evaluate, and execute profitable acquisitions.
Learning outcomes typically include mastering due diligence processes, developing comprehensive acquisition plans, understanding financial modeling techniques relevant to small business valuations, and negotiating favorable terms. Students gain practical experience through case studies and simulations, preparing them for real-world scenarios.
The program duration varies, but generally ranges from a few months to a year, depending on the intensity and curriculum design. Many programs offer flexible learning options to accommodate the busy schedules of working professionals seeking to enhance their business acumen and leadership skills.
